Job Description

This role provides comprehensive design and production support for the Division of Advancement and External Affairs' Office of Strategic Communications and Donor Experience. This role creates and manages visual content for fundraising, engagement and stewardship materials across all print and digital platforms. This position is responsible for sourcing, organizing, cataloging, and retouching media assets for division-wide use. The incumbent uses and develops templates and support systems/platforms that enable self-service options for commonly used pieces. This position works with the AVP to ensure digital and print materials produced within the division align with University brand, marketing and communications standards, as well as style guidelines. Working closely with the Director of Digital Experience, the Production Designer will help facilitate the production of physical collateral and help liaise with Procurement and vendors. The position requires creativity and systematic organization to manage the division's visual assets and production workflows effectively.

Responsibilities
  • Design and produce fundraising, engagement and stewardship collateral for print and digital distribution.
  • Create layouts that effectively communicate messaging while maintaining visual appeal and brand compliance.
  • Collaborate with communications staff to understand project goals and translate content into compelling visual designs.
  • Ensure all materials meet professional standards and advance divisional objectives.
  • Develop and/or refresh templates for common collateral pieces to enable more self-service production options.
  • Create flexible, user-friendly templates that maintain brand standards while allowing non-designers to produce quality ad-hoc materials.
  • Document template usage and assist with providing training to staff on proper usage.
  • Provide design support for systems that facilitate self-start or self-service materials.
  • Source, organize and retouch photography and other media assets for use across the division.
  • Edit and retouch images to meet quality standards and project requirements.
  • Establish relationships with other media staff throughout the University to ensure a rich pool of resources for completing projects requiring media assets.
  • Provide design and visual expertise as needed.
  • Conduct design review and evaluation to ensure compliance with University brand standards. Review materials produced internally and by external partners for adherence to brand guidelines and divisional goals.
  • Provide constructive feedback and guidance to improve quality across the division.
  • Remain current on University brand standards and fundraising industry design and layout trends.
  • Support and assist the Director of Digital Experience on print collateral production.
  • Coordinate with University Procurement and external vendors to ensure quality production and timely delivery.
  • Prepare files for print production, including proper color management and specifications.
  • Monitor production quality and troubleshoot issues as they arise.

About the Syracuse area

Syracuse is a medium-sized city situated in the geographic center of New York State approximately 250 miles northwest of New York City. The metro-area population totals approximately 500,000. The area offers a low cost of living and provides many social, cultural, and recreational options, including parks, museums, festivals, professional regional theater, and premier shopping venues. Syracuse and Central New York present a wide range of seasonal recreation and attractions ranging from water skiing and snow skiing, hiking in the Adirondacks, touring the historic sites, visiting wineries along the Finger Lakes, and biking on trails along the Erie Canal.

Commitment to Supporting and Hiring Veterans

Syracuse University has a long history of engaging veterans and the military-connected community through its educational programs, community outreach, and employment programs. After World War II, Syracuse University welcomed more than 10,000 returning veterans to our campus, and those veterans literally transformed Syracuse University into the national research institution it is today. The University's contemporary commitment to veterans builds on this historical legacy, and extends to both class-leading initiatives focused on making an SU degree accessible and affordable to the post-9/11 generation of veterans, and also programs designed to position Syracuse University as the employer of choice for military veterans, members of the Guard and Reserve, and military family members.
